
With today’s competitive online marketplace, frontend team project managers are increasingly discovering that Vue.js is being utilized as a framework of choice for future web applications. Renowned for simplicity, flexibility, and progressive design, Vue.js enables programmers to build incredibly high-performance and maintainable UIs. But as a project manager, technical superiority simply will not cut it โ aligning the development process, delivery timelines, and cross-functional collaboration is the key.
Vue.js entails unique development patterns, such as reactive data binding, single-file components, and scoped styles, that are unique compared to other leading frameworks, such as React or Angular. These features affect the way project planning, task estimation, and QA processes should be addressed, and without clear knowledge of how Vue.js projects are structured and scaled, even experienced managers risk experiencing late deadlines, scope creep, or poor stakeholder visibility.
What You Need to Know About the Vue.js Development Environment
For frontend project managers, a good grasp of the Vue.js ecosystem is not merely useful โ it’s beneficial for the business. Vue.js, a progressive JavaScript framework, is gaining popularity due to its mix of simplicity and power. Its design philosophy allows teams to scale applications efficiently without introducing excessive complexity, making it ideal for startup-level as well as enterprise-grade products.
Core Architecture: Component-Driven and Reactive
At the heart of Vue.js is a component-based system in which all pieces of UI are encapsulated in a single-file component (SFC) made up of its HTML, CSS, and JavaScript. This structure promotes reusability, eases maintenance, and accelerates onboarding, especially when applying modular design systems.
Also important is Vue’s reactivity system. The state of the application updates automatically in the UI, reducing hand-manipulated DOM updates and the possibility of bugs caused by out-of-date views of the data. Project managers can note that it eases development but also requires discipline in managing state changes and tracking dependencies.
Development Tooling and Workflow Integration
A standard Vue.js tech stack includes:
- Vue CLI: Robust scaffolding tool that manages project setup, linting, hot-reloading, and build optimization.
- Vue Router: Supports SPA navigation with route guards and lazy loading.
- Vuex: A State management library that allows for centralized management of complex state logic between components.
- Vite (slowly replacing Vue CLI): Offers much faster development builds and module resolution.
Project managers must also collaborate with DevOps or tech leads in order to integrate the tools into the CI/CD pipeline correctly. These are automated test support, code quality enforcement, and monitoring performance.
Key Considerations for Project Managers
Managing a Vue.js project is more than task assignment. It is coordinating the team workflow with the strengths of the ecosystem while buffering its idiosyncrasies. Some practical tips include:
- Establish Clear Coding Standards (e.g., directory structure, component naming convention, Vue style guide) to enable consistency across the codebase.
- Make Provision for Component Library Building, especially if the app requires an even and polished UI.
- Monitor the Complexity of the Shared State. Vuex is powerful, but can become a bottleneck when overused. PMs need to encourage frequent refactoring or modularization of store logic.
- Invest in Quality Documentation and Onboarding Materials, especially for less experienced developers or those new to reactive concepts.
Summary
Vue.js allows teams to build high-performing, sustainable UIs quickly, but how well the environment is set up and managed makes all the difference. A project manager familiar with the basics โ from reactive data binding to Vuex modularization โ can properly avoid blockers in advance, keep estimates accurate, and facilitate a healthy development rhythm.
By learning the frontend language and understanding how Vue.js is structured, project managers will be able to lead better, anticipate technical constraints, and eventually have more stable outputs.
Project Management Approaches for Vue.js Teams
Vue.js encourages developers to structure applications into small, reusable components. Likewise, project managers need to follow the same pattern by breaking down tasks. Instead of assigning big goals such as “implement homepage,” define work items in terms of individual parts such as headers, sliders, or CTA space. This enables simultaneous development, faster QA, and fewer merge conflicts.
Forcing Codebase Consistency
Since Vue is neutral regarding folder structure or coding standards, there needs to be intentional enforcement of consistency. Project managers need to work with technical leads to come up with standards early, from component naming conventions to state management patterns (e.g., Vuex vs. Pinia) and testing procedures. Establishing this ahead of time avoids code drift, decreases onboarding time, and keeps technical debt in check.
Optimizing Agile for Vue Workflows
Vue’s prototyping speed can accelerate iteration, but that speed requires discipline. Agile rituals must be bent by project managers to highlight integration dependencies and user experience flow. Examples include:
- In standups, emergent risk is linked to shared components or simultaneous edits.
- During sprint reviews, prioritize demoing real frontend interactions, albeit backed up with mock data.
These adjustments make stakeholders capable of agreeing on UX decisions early and thereby lowering rework.
Aligning Tools Across Teams
Cross-functional collaboration is dependent on quality tooling. Figma and Zeplin, for instance, streamline design-to-code workflows, and Swagger or Postman provide neat API communication between front and back end. And ensuring that test automation frameworks like Cypress or Vue Test Utils are part of sprints from day one sets the tone for a high-quality release pipeline.
Managing Speed Without Sacrificing Quality
Vue supports rapid development, but unchecked velocity generates technical debt. Project leaders must craft timelines that balance speed with refactoring and testing. Encourage short, narrowly scoped pull requests, insist on peer review discipline, and establish a stabilization buffer for features prior to release โ the result: a codebase that expands without collapsing.
Vue.js PM Cheat Sheet: What to Remember
Tactic | Why It Matters | Tip for PMs |
Define component boundaries | Keeps code modular and testable | Encourage devs to follow the Single-Responsibility Principle |
Align on state management | Prevents architecture drift and bugs | Standardize on Vuex or Pinia based on project size |
Continuous Integration | Catches errors early in the pipeline | Integrate unit and E2E tests in CI tools |
Stakeholder-friendly demos | Ensures the product meets business goals | Plan demos around key user flows, not code |
Timeboxing iterations | Maintains momentum and feature scope | Use two-week sprints with review checkpoints |
Conclusion
Effective management of Vue.js projects in 2025 demands balancing technical knowledge with strategic leadership. With the shift towards more complicated frontend architectures, successful delivery depends more and more on great communication, planning at the component level, and anticipating risks.
Project managers who take the time to learn the basic mechanics of Vue.js โ component trees, state management frameworks like Vuex or Pinia, and the reactive nature of the framework โ are more likely to create realistic schedules, plan for chokepoints, and align development with business goals.
By using tried-and-tested approaches such as maintaining coding standards consistently, enforcing version control processes, and prioritizing demo-complete builds, managers can reduce development friction and optimize cross-functional collaboration.
Suggested articles:
- Why Blazor is a Reliable Framework for Modern .NET Web Development
- 7 Project Management Strategies to Speed Up Your Python Development
- For What Business Is Generative AI Development Relevant?
Daniel Raymond, a project manager with over 20 years of experience, is the former CEO of a successful software company called Websystems. With a strong background in managing complex projects, he applied his expertise to develop AceProject.com and Bridge24.com, innovative project management tools designed to streamline processes and improve productivity. Throughout his career, Daniel has consistently demonstrated a commitment to excellence and a passion for empowering teams to achieve their goals.